
The General Data Protection Regulation (GDPR) has had a profound impact on the way data is handled in Europe and beyond. For developers, tech enthusiasts and companies, understanding the GDPR is not just a legal obligation, but a crucial aspect of maintaining trust and integrity in the digital world. In this article, we’ll explore what the GDPR is, its fundamental principles and how it specifically affects the tech community. In addition, we’ll discuss the implications of the GDPR in Portugal and provide a link to more detailed information on the subject.
What is the GDPR?
The GDPR, which came into force on 25 May 2018, is a regulation by which the European Union (EU) aims to protect the personal data of its citizens. It sets out guidelines for the collection, storage and processing of personal information and gives individuals greater control over their data.
Key principles of the GDPR
Understanding the key principles of the GDPR is essential for compliance. Here are the basic principles:
- Lawfulness, fairness and transparency: Data processing must be lawful, fair and transparent for the data subject.
- Purpose limitation: The data must be collected for specific, explicit and legitimate purposes and must not be processed in a manner incompatible with those purposes.
- Data minimisation: The data collected must be adequate, relevant and limited to what is necessary for the intended purpose.
- Accuracy: Personal data must be accurate and kept up to date.
- Storage limitation: Data must be kept in a format that allows identification of data subjects only for a necessary period.
- Integrity and Confidentiality: Data must be processed in a manner that ensures adequate security, including protection against unauthorised or unlawful processing and against accidental loss, destruction or damage.
- Accountability: Data controllers are responsible for and must be able to demonstrate compliance with the GDPR.
Impact of the GDPR on developers and technology enthusiasts
For developers and tech enthusiasts, especially those using collaboration and documentation platforms like hackmd.io, GDPR compliance is key. Here are some key areas where the GDPR impacts your work:
1. Data collection and processing
Developers must ensure that any personal data collected is done so with explicit consent and for a specific purpose. This includes data collected via apps, websites and other digital platforms.
2. Data security
Security is an important focus of the GDPR. As a developer, you must implement robust security measures to protect personal data from breaches and cyber attacks. This includes encryption, secure coding practices and regular security audits.
3. User rights
The GDPR grants several rights to data subjects, including the right to access their data, the right to rectification, the right to erasure (the ‘right to be forgotten’) and the right to data portability. Developers need to create systems that allow users to exercise these rights easily.
4. Data transfers
If your platform or application transfers data outside the EU, you must ensure that the transfer complies with the requirements of the GDPR. This often involves using approved data transfer mechanisms, such as standard contractual clauses or binding corporate rules.
5. Documentation and record-keeping
The GDPR requires meticulous documentation of data processing activities. Developers must keep records of data collection, processing activities, consent forms and security measures to demonstrate compliance.
GDPR in Portugal
Portugal, as an EU member state, is fully subject to the GDPR. In addition to the GDPR, Portugal has its own national legislation that complements the regulation. The National Data Protection Authority (CNPD) oversees the application of data protection laws in the country.
For more detailed information on the GDPR in Portugal, including national specificities and guidelines, visit GDPR in Portugal.
Practical Steps for Compliance
Here are some practical steps for developers and tech enthusiasts to ensure GDPR compliance:
- Conduct Data Audits: Regularly review and audit the data you collect and process. Identify personal data and ensure it is being handled in compliance with GDPR principles.
- Implement Privacy by Design: Incorporate data protection measures from the outset of any project. This includes minimizing data collection, securing data storage, and ensuring data accuracy.
- Educate and Train: Ensure that your team is well-versed in GDPR requirements. Provide training on data protection best practices and keep up to date with any regulatory changes.
- Use Secure Platforms: Choose platforms and tools that are GDPR compliant. For instance, when using hackmd.io, ensure that your collaborative documents do not contain unnecessary personal data and that access controls are in place.
GDPR is a critical aspect of data protection that affects developers, tech enthusiasts, and businesses alike. By understanding and adhering to its principles, you can ensure that you handle personal data responsibly and maintain trust with your users. Stay informed about GDPR requirements and implement best practices to safeguard data and uphold privacy standards.
